I'd get a trigger job on my service model once I had my SC as my carry gun.
I'd have night sights on the SC. No other mods on carry gun as I feel it can be a liability to have a "tricked out" gun as your carry weapon. I'd never port a carry weapon either. Close quarters shooting and you've blinded yourself or gotten hit with hot gas and debris from your own gun.
